Top Nintendo Games Featuring Snow

Alright, let's get into the best Nintendo games that truly nail the snow theme. First up, we have "Mario & Sonic at the Olympic Winter Games." This series is all about the thrill of winter sports. You can compete in everything from skiing and snowboarding to ice skating and bobsledding. The controls are intuitive, making it easy for anyone to pick up and play, and the colorful graphics bring the excitement of the Winter Olympics to life. Whether you're racing down a ski slope or performing gravity-defying jumps on a snowboard, this game is sure to get your adrenaline pumping.

Next, we can't forget "SSX 3" on the GameCube! This snowboarding game is a classic for a reason. With its open-world mountain, killer soundtrack, and over-the-top tricks, "SSX 3" offers an unparalleled sense of freedom and excitement. Carving through fresh powder and mastering insane jumps is an absolute blast, and the game's stylish visuals still hold up today. If you're a fan of extreme sports, "SSX 3" is a must-play.

For those who prefer a more relaxed experience, "Animal Crossing: New Horizons" offers a charming take on winter. As the seasons change in your virtual town, snow blankets the landscape, transforming it into a winter wonderland. You can build snowmen, catch snowflakes, and even participate in festive events like the Winter Solstice. The game's cozy atmosphere and adorable characters make it the perfect way to unwind and embrace the magic of winter. The winter season brings unique DIY recipes and items, encouraging players to get creative and decorate their islands with festive flair. From twinkling lights to cozy winter clothing, there's no shortage of ways to celebrate the season in "Animal Crossing: New Horizons."

Let's also give a shout-out to "The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ild." The Hebra Mountains region is a vast, snowy expanse that presents a unique set of challenges and opportunities. Link must bundle up in warm clothing to survive the freezing temperatures, and the slippery terrain adds an extra layer of difficulty to traversal. But the rewards are well worth the effort, as the Hebra region is home to hidden shrines, challenging enemies, and breathtaking vistas. Gliding through the snowy peaks and discovering ancient secrets is an unforgettable experience.

The Technical Side: Creating Believable Snow

Ever wondered how Nintendo makes snow look so darn good? Well, it's all about the technical wizardry behind the scenes. Game developers use a variety of techniques to create believable snow effects, from advanced lighting models to dynamic particle systems. One of the key challenges is making snow look realistic while also ensuring that it doesn't bog down the game's performance. This requires careful optimization and a deep understanding of the hardware capabilities of the Nintendo Switch and other consoles. For example, developers might use tessellation to add detail to snow surfaces, making them look more bumpy and uneven. They might also use parallax mapping to create the illusion of depth, even on flat surfaces. And of course, lighting is crucial for creating the right mood and atmosphere. By using advanced lighting techniques, developers can simulate the way that light interacts with snow, creating realistic highlights and shadows. Particle systems are another important tool for creating snow effects. These systems allow developers to simulate the movement of individual snowflakes, creating a sense of depth and realism. By adjusting the size, shape, and density of the particles, they can create everything from gentle flurries to raging blizzards. And finally, physics plays a key role in making snow feel believable. Developers use physics engines to simulate the way that snow interacts with the environment, allowing characters to leave footprints in the snow and snowballs to roll down hills. This level of detail adds a layer of immersion to the game world, making it feel more alive and responsive.
